CHICKEN WITH PEAR AND BLUE CHEESE SALAD



Chicken With Pear and Blue Cheese Salad image

I discovered this recipe in a cook book I recently purchased. It sounds delicious! I have not tried it, but I have chosen to share the recipe with you. Cook time is marinade time for the chicken. Hope you enjoy!

Provided by Bobtail

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 4h20m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 18

2 ounces olive oil
6 shallots, sliced
1 clove garlic, crushed
2 tablespoons chopped fresh tarragon
1 tablespoon English mustard
6 boneless skinless chicken breasts
1 tablespoon flour
2/3 cup chicken stock
1 apple, diced finely
1 tablespoon chopped walnuts
1 tablespoon heavy cream
salt and pepper
3 1/2 cups cooked rice
2 large pears, diced
1 cup blue cheese, diced
1 red bell pepper, diced
1 tablespoon chopped fresh coriander
1 tablespoon sesame oil

Steps:

  • In a deep bowl, mix olive oil, shallots, garlic, tarragon and mustard.
  • Salt and pepper to taste.
  • Place the chicken breasts in this mixture, coating well.
  • Chill for 4 hours.
  • Drain the chicken, reserving the marinade.
  • Quickly fry the chicken in a deep non-stick pan for 4 minutes on each side.
  • Transfer the chicken to a large serving platter.
  • Add the marinade to the pan, bring to a boil and sprinkle with the flour.
  • Add the chicken stock, apples and walnuts.
  • Gently simmer for 5 minutes.
  • Return the chicken to the pan with the sauce in it.
  • Add the heavy cream and cook for 2 minutes.
  • Mix the salad ingredients together and place a small amount on each plate.
  • Top each plate with a chicken breast and a spoonful of the sauce.
  • Serve immediately.

GRIDDLED PEAR & BLUE CHEESE SALAD



Griddled pear & blue cheese salad image

Contrast sweet grilled fruit with salty robust blue cheese and a honey vinaigrette in this stylish salad

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Lunch, Main course

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 7

4 firm, ripe pears , sliced lengthways into 1cm slices
2 tbsp olive oil
1 tbsp white wine vinegar
1 tbsp honey
250g bag mixed salad leaf
150g pack blue cheese , crumbled
crusty bread , to serve (optional)

Steps:

  • Put the pears in a bowl and drizzle with 1 tsp of the oil. Heat a griddle pan, then cook the pears, in batches, for 1 min on each side. Set aside to cool.
  • Mix the remaining oil, vinegar and honey. Toss the pears, leaves and cheese, divide between 4 plates and drizzle with the dressing. Serve with bread, if you like.

PEAR AND BLUE CHEESE SALAD



Pear and Blue Cheese Salad image

This salad brings together ingredients that really enhance each other, and the dressing packs a perfect punch with maple syrup, brown sugar, and apple cider vinegar. It's a favorite in my family!

Provided by SPERL25

Categories     Salad     Green Salad Recipes

Time 15m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 (10 ounce) bag mixed field greens
½ cup sliced red onion
1 Bosc pear, cored and sliced
½ cup chopped candied pecans
½ cup crumbled blue cheese
¼ cup maple syrup
⅓ cup apple cider vinegar
½ cup mayonnaise
2 tablespoons packed brown sugar
¾ te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
¼ cup walnut oil

Steps:

  • Place the salad greens in a large bowl. Add the red onion, pear, pecans, and blue cheese, and toss to mix evenly.
  • To make the dressing, place the maple syrup, vinegar, mayonnaise, brown sugar, salt, and pepper in a blender, and blend thoroughly. With the motor running, slowly pour in the walnut oil. Blend until mixture becomes creamy, about 1 minute. Pour over salad mixture, and toss to coat greens evenly. Serve immediately.
